Web13 apr. 2024 · To do this, follow these steps: 2.1.1. Turning off the main breaker. Locate the main breaker switch in your electrical panel, which is typically a larger switch than the others, and flip it to the "off" position. This will shut off power to all the circuits in your home, ensuring a safe working environment. 2.1.2. WebThe circuit breaker off position doesn’t harm the device.
